Job Description

The Prescott Library at The Wheeler School in Providence, RI, provides a safe and nurturing environment for students, faculty, and staff and works to ensure that students from grades N-12 develop essential skills needed to navigate the rapidly evolving information landscape of the 21st century.

Job Summary and Duties: Library Aide

The Library Aide provides clerical, administrative and tech support including, managing the circulation desk, assisting with the public access catalog, processing new books, working with the Follett Destiny report feature, ordering materials, and supplies, and any work deemed necessary to support the library program (s), in the Lower, Middle, and Upper School Libraries. This position will provide support in classrooms for Lower School Library Classes during remote/hybrid learning.  This is a part-time academic year position of 20 hours per week.
